> Mich the SELF challenge is sponsored by Self magazine. It involves

monitoring

> your food intake, exercising so many times per week, stretching

etc. Each

> week you add an additional positive behavior to your regimen. It

lasts for

> three months. The first 2000 people to complete the challenge and

send in

> their forms will have their names printed in the magazine. There

are also

> several opportunities to win prizes. Check out Self.com for some of

the

> details.
